Bitdeer Technologies Group's Q4 2024 Financial Overview

Bitdeer Technologies Group's Financial Results Analysis
Bitdeer Technologies Group (NASDAQ: BTDR), a prominent player in blockchain technology and high-performance computing, has recently unveiled its unaudited financial results for the final quarter of 2024. The announcement sheds light on the company's performance, revealing significant shifts in revenue and expenses compared to the previous year.
Financial Highlights for Q4 2024
The company reported total revenue of approximately US$69.0 million for Q4 2024, a notable decline from US$114.8 million in the same quarter of the previous year. This decrease underscores the company's ongoing challenges amidst evolving market dynamics.
Revenue Breakdown
In a detailed breakdown, self-mining revenue stood at US$41.5 million compared to US$46.9 million last year. This dip was impacted by the halving event in April, coupled with a heightened global hashrate. However, the average self-mining hashrate improved by 20%, reaching 8.4 EH/s, signaling potential for growth despite recent adversities.
Cost of Revenue Insights
On the flip side, the cost of revenue for Bitdeer decreased significantly to US$63.9 million from US$87.8 million. This positive development is attributed to reduced power usage and depreciation expenses as a number of mining rigs became fully depreciated.

Operational Summary
As of the end of Q4 2024, Bitdeer managed a total hashrate of 21.6 EH/s. This was an increase from 21.0 EH/s the previous year, highlighting the company’s commitment to growth despite current hurdles. The management is ramping up production of SEALMINER ASICs aimed at bolstering self-mining efficiencies and revenue diversification.
Hashrate Management Metrics
- Proprietary hash rate: 8.9 EH/s
- Self-mining: 8.5 EH/s
- Hosting: 12.7 EH/s

Challenges Ahead
Despite the positive developments, the net loss reported for Q4 was substantial at US$531.9 million, substantially higher than the loss of US$5.0 million reported in the prior year. This increase highlights the ongoing financial pressures the company faces amid shifting market conditions and heightened operational costs.
